Do you ever wonder what a bus journey to school is like for young neurodivergent people?

Crowd
Noise
Different smells

How many young people turn up for school in a bad mood, because they were overstimulated on the way there?

The lack of barrcode saved me from an impulsive purchase today, and had to leave a beautiful water bottle at the self check out till....

(yes, another one, because maybe a new bottle will help me increase daily water intake)....

(It probably would, for a day or two) ....

(And it looks pretty, and will fit with the other glass items)...

(Do I really need it though?).....

That was a tipping point, which when crossed could create a future feeling of regret.

Was it just luck?
The fact the bottle didn't have a barrcode sticker on?

Or was is an unconcious decision,
made at the point of chosing the bottle?

I have observed that people have different ways of expressing their feelings and emotions.

For example:

❤️ When a little boy leaves the last piece of chocolate for his mother.

❤️ Or a friend who asks you how your doctor's appointment went.

❤️ Or a family member who brings you a souvenir from vacation.

🤔 It can also be stomping your feet on the floor

🤔 Or refusal to participate in an activity.

In the world called neurodiverse... it is not always easy to describe feelings and emotions.

So let's observe the details, behind the words which are not being said out loud.
